Performance Sensitivity Analysis

Analysis

Performance Sensitivity Analysis, within cryptocurrency, options, and derivatives, quantifies the impact of changing input variables on a model’s output, revealing vulnerabilities and informing robust strategy development. It moves beyond static risk measures by assessing how portfolio performance reacts to shifts in parameters like implied volatility, correlation, or underlying asset price movements. This process is crucial for understanding the potential range of outcomes and managing exposure in rapidly evolving markets, particularly where liquidity can be fragmented. Effective implementation requires a clear understanding of the model’s assumptions and the potential for non-linear relationships between inputs and outputs.
